The vine has very high vigor. The leaf is rounded, slightly dissected, three- or five-lobed, with an open lyre-shaped petiole sinus and absent pubescence on the underside. The flower is hermaphroditic. The bunch is large, conical, medium-dense. The berry is medium-sized, rounded, white with a thick waxy coating and thin skin.
The variety belongs to the medium-late maturity group and is characterized as high-yielding. The berries are juicy and have a harmonious taste. The grape shows resistance to diseases. When used in winemaking, the variety allows for the production of white wines with a straw-yellow hue.
